I am trying to test and validate the design of walls with the task “Column design”. For walls I want to turn off the minimum reinforcement according to EN 1992-1-1 9.5.2 (2) and use 9.6.2 (1) instead. In program column there is an option CTRL WALL, but that seems not to work. Is the only option for me to change the en200x.ini file or is there other options. I would prefer not changing the en200x.ini file.

Hi Martin,

if you use a standard cross section of type “wall” for the column, the minimum reinforcement for walls according 9.6.2(1) will be used.

This could work:

SREC no 111 h 40[cm] b - TITL ‘wall-type (b=1m)’ rtyp cu $ btyp u and wall : no steel on the shorter/transversal sides
SREC no 112 h 40[cm] b 50[cm] TITL 'column-type ’ rtyp cu
SREC no 113 h 40[cm] b 100[cm] TITL 'column-type ’ rtyp cu $ btyp u and column: steel on the shorter/transversal sides

Thank you, ragl!

I tried your suggestion and indeed the type of cross section depends whether you explicitly give width B a dimension or not.
